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44069083 715704844 255 8282 21890
51057 539
51057 539
7053157 14505530325 031750302
All about undefined
Interested in learning more?
51057 539
7053157 14505530325 031750302
See more
07 4627
38094284225 984942 324557643
See more
949780 57277 0198061404
907883 04777 631366227
See more